Although organizations are aware of the benefits of enterprise architectures models, organizations have difficulties determining deficiencies in their business architecture. Organizational assessment tools often do not achieve expectations as sold to management. Performance measures often fail to properly represent necessary holistic measurements. Methods for capturing deficiencies in current business models and deterring improvements to optimize business processes are rare. This thesis develops a new experimental architecture modeling approach for enterprise transformations. The approach is efficient in capturing deficiencies and finding correlations which can become targeted goals for improvements. The intention of this research is to develop a new algorithm that it is mainly focus in the principle of echolocation or also called biosonar. This principle is active in many animals such as: birds, shrews, dolphins and bats, these last ones are going to be a fundamental part of our study. These animals use it as radar in order to find food, obstacles or just to locate objects.

Planning is an important cognitive work activity. To support this complex task, the development of planning tools is important to support people during decision-making and problem-solving tasks. Nowadays, a large number of manual and electronic tools support this complex activity; manual and electronic planning tools aid people in creating strategies for effective work performance. However, there is limited information on the design of generic planning tools people use for their activities, and why people choose to use the planning tool they do. Some examples of generic tools for planning are calendars, checklists, agendas, etc.
